Our Students

Venture International Academy students will come from diverse countries around the world. While they may have different hobbies and interests, students share many of the traits necessary to be a successful exchange student: flexibility, maturity, friendliness, and curiosity about the world around them. Students must be between the ages of 12-18 and can enroll either for one semester (August-January or January-June) or for the full academic year (August-June).

DAY & BOARDING SCHOOL PROGRAM STUDENTS
Prior to acceptance onto the program, students are carefully screened through an in-depth application and interview process. Students must be recommended by a teacher in their home country and have a good command of the English language for the day and boarding school programs.
In addition, they must demonstrate that they are motivated to learn about the American way of life and to participate in family, school and civic activities.

Since school is an integral part of the exchange experience. It is essential that the student becomes an active part of that system. Students are encouraged to participate in extra-curricular activities that are offered in each school. In addition, the student will take courses typical of an American his or her age, including US History and English course. School attendance is required by the Department of State, in order that the student’s visa remains valid.
